Name: Spectinamide-1599
CAS#: unknown
Chemical Formula: C21H34Br3ClN4O7
Exact Mass: 725.97
Molecular Weight: 729.686
Elemental Analysis: C, 34.57; H, 4.70; Br, 32.85; Cl, 4.86; N, 7.68; O, 15.35
